Wade Salem - Founder
Wade comes from a coaching family and has worked for over a decade with hundreds of coaches and teams from schools, colleges, leagues, sports facilities and pro camps. From playing, coaching and consulting, Wade brings a unique insight and clarity to coaching character. An exceptional leader, speaker and motivator, Wade is dedicated to equipping coaches to develop the “Complete Player.” He currently lives in Surprise, AZ with his beautiful wife Jamie and their children Jordan, Breanna, and Christian.

John Callahan - Character Consultant
John graduated from Capital University with Honors and has worked in the fields of social work and chemical dependency. John is seasoned in family and group therapy, and motivational speaking for schools, sport, and business organizations. Since 2006 he has worked at the Edge Sports Performance Academy in Twinsburg, Ohio promoting character in sports
through Jr. Edge and youth camps and clinics. In recent years he has channeled his talents into sports character development by joining Coaching 4 Life. John has coached youth football since 1993, he is married, has two sons, and is actively involved in youth sports.

Mike Orazen - President
Mike comes to Coaching 4 Life with vast experiences in developing teams and culture. While spending the first 15 years of his career in his family’s manufacturing business, Mike was a leader in creating competitive advantages by building vision, values, and commitment at all organizational levels. He has consistently used the same philosophy while coaching youth sports, with equally successful results. Mike met Wade in 2007, and quickly realized that Coaching 4 Life was a thoughtful and logical breakdown of everything he already believed and lived. Mike is committed to helping others begin and work through the "process" of equipping coaches to be intentional about integrating character development in their sport. Mike ultimately believes this will result in individual and community change for a better world. Mike resides in Hudson, OH with his wife Kerrie and their children Max, Will, and Kate.

Dr. Lew Sterrett - Presenter
Lew is a Master Trainer and teams up with Wade in the C4L Timeout video as a featured guest. He uses horses to illustrate basic relational principles that govern all human relationships. This dynamic visual training mechanism has proven beneficial for all leadership levels. Lew’s insight into "Training," and his multiple demonstrations with horses, illustrate the relationship between the coach and the player, and helps coaches increase their influence and expand their leadership realm.
